Existing Client? Sign In

Aneumind

Greenwood Village, CO
Video Office

Video Office

A street map for office location at Greenwood Village, CO 80111-3010

Aneumind HQ

Greenwood Village, CO 80111-3010

A street map for office location at Greenwood Village, CO 80111-2965

Phone Consultation

Greenwood Village, CO 80111-2965